What Factors Should You Consider When Selecting the Best Solar RV Kit?
When selecting the best solar RV kit, several key factors should be taken into consideration to ensure optimal performance and compatibility with your RV’s needs.
- Power Requirements: Assessing your RV’s power needs is crucial. This involves calculating the total wattage of all appliances and devices you plan to use, allowing you to choose a solar kit that can provide sufficient energy to meet those demands.
- Type of Solar Panels: There are different types of solar panels, including monocrystalline, polycrystalline, and thin-film. Monocrystalline panels are more efficient and space-saving, while polycrystalline panels are generally less expensive but take up more space; thin-film panels are lightweight but typically have lower efficiency.
- Battery Storage: Incorporating a battery storage system is vital for capturing solar energy for use during the night or cloudy days. Consider the capacity and type of batteries, such as lithium or AGM, to ensure they can handle your energy needs and last long-term.
- Inverter Quality: An inverter is necessary to convert the direct current (DC) generated by solar panels into alternating current (AC) for household appliances. Choosing a high-quality inverter ensures efficiency and reliability, and it’s important to match its power rating with your anticipated load.
- Installation Flexibility: Some solar RV kits offer easier installation processes, which can be a significant factor if you prefer a DIY approach. Look for kits with comprehensive instructions and all necessary components, or consider professional installation if needed.
- Durability and Warranty: Solar panels and accessories should be durable enough to withstand various weather conditions during travel. Check the warranty offered by manufacturers, as a longer warranty may indicate greater confidence in the product’s longevity and performance.
- Budget: Establishing a budget will help narrow down options while still meeting your energy needs. Solar RV kits vary widely in price, so it’s essential to find a balance between cost and quality to avoid overspending on unnecessary features.

What Types of Solar Panels Are Commonly Included in Solar RV Kits?
The common types of solar panels included in solar RV kits are:
- Monocrystalline Solar Panels: These panels are made from a single continuous crystal structure, which allows them to have higher efficiency rates, typically between 15% to 20% or more. They are known for their longevity and space efficiency, making them ideal for RVs where space is limited.
- Polycrystalline Solar Panels: Composed of multiple crystal structures, these panels are generally less efficient than monocrystalline panels, with efficiency ratings around 13% to 16%. They are often more affordable and provide a good balance between cost and performance, making them popular for budget-conscious RV owners.
- Flexible Solar Panels: These panels are lightweight and can be easily mounted on curved surfaces, which is beneficial for RVs with unique designs. While they may have slightly lower efficiency compared to rigid panels, their versatility and ease of installation make them a favorite for those who need a portable solution.
- Bifacial Solar Panels: This innovative type captures sunlight on both sides, allowing for increased energy production especially in reflective environments. Although they can be more expensive, their ability to harness additional light can make them a compelling option for RV enthusiasts looking for maximum efficiency.
What Are the Key Components of a High-Quality Solar RV Kit?
The key components of a high-quality solar RV kit include:
- Solar Panels: These are the heart of the solar kit, converting sunlight into usable electricity. The efficiency, wattage, and type (monocrystalline or polycrystalline) of the panels can significantly affect the overall performance and output of the system.
- Charge Controller: This device regulates the voltage and current coming from the solar panels to the batteries, ensuring they are charged properly without overcharging. A good charge controller also protects the battery from discharging too deeply, which can extend its lifespan.
- Batteries: Batteries store the electricity generated by the solar panels for use when sunlight is not available. The capacity and type of battery (lead-acid, lithium-ion, etc.) are crucial, as they determine how much energy can be stored and how long it can be used.
- Inverter: This component converts the direct current (DC) electricity stored in the batteries into alternating current (AC) electricity that can be used to power standard household appliances. Choosing the right inverter (pure sine wave vs. modified sine wave) is important for compatibility with your devices.
- Mounting Hardware: Quality mounting brackets and hardware are essential for securely attaching the solar panels to your RV. This ensures that they remain stable during travel and can withstand various weather conditions.
- Cabling and Connectors: The right gauge of wiring and connectors ensures efficient power transfer between components. Poor quality or incorrect sizing can lead to energy loss and overheating, impacting the system’s overall performance.
- Monitoring System: Some advanced solar kits come with monitoring systems that allow you to track the performance of your solar setup in real-time. This can help you optimize energy use and identify any issues early on.

What Installation Tips Can Help You Set Up Your Solar RV Kit Effectively?
To effectively set up your solar RV kit, consider the following installation tips:
- Choose the Right Location: Select a flat, unobstructed area on your RV’s roof for panel installation to maximize sunlight exposure.
- Use Quality Mounting Hardware: Invest in durable mounting brackets and hardware to ensure that solar panels are securely attached and can withstand wind and weather conditions.
- Properly Wire the System: Follow the manufacturer’s wiring diagrams carefully, ensuring that connections are secure and waterproof to prevent short circuits and damage.
- Incorporate a Charge Controller: Install a charge controller between the solar panels and the battery to regulate voltage and prevent overcharging, which can prolong battery life.
- Test the System Before Use: Once installed, conduct a thorough test of the entire system to ensure all components are functioning correctly and efficiently.
Choosing the right location for your solar panels is critical, as it affects their efficiency. A flat surface allows for better mounting and ensures that the panels receive optimal sunlight without any shadows from vents, air conditioners, or other obstructions.
Using quality mounting hardware is essential for the longevity of the installation. High-quality brackets will resist corrosion and provide a secure hold, minimizing the risk of panels becoming loose or detached during travel.
Properly wiring the system is vital for safety and functionality. Make sure all connections are tight and insulated, and use waterproof connectors if possible, as moisture can lead to electrical failures.
A charge controller is a necessary component that protects your batteries from being overcharged, which can damage them and reduce their lifespan. It ensures that the energy from the solar panels is safely directed to the batteries.
Lastly, testing the system after installation allows you to catch any issues early on. Check the output voltage and current, and ensure that all components are working as intended before relying on the system for power during your travels.
